**About LOOPHOLES**

*Loopholes* is an anthology of new dance works, created by the students of TDM 90CR, exploring culture, conflict, and carbohydrates. Prompted by visiting lecturers Ali Kenner Brodsky and Andy Russ to consider the dancing body in the digital world, Judy Epstein ‘27, Crystal Manyloun ‘26, Matondo Mihalache ‘29, Salem Shubash ‘29, and Izzy Wilson ‘26 have created a multi-course, multimedia spectacle that interweaves strands of live performance, projected video, and hybrid experimentation.
